There are a lot of features to incorporate into contemporary bathroom design. If you are interested in creating a high-end bathroom, you may want to consider features such as:
walk-in showers with multi showerheads; radiant heating for tile floors; whirlpool spa bathtubs; glass shower doors; luxurious custom cabinetry; and elegant tile.
The first step in planning a contemporary bathroom design is to evaluate the structure of your home. Some of these elements are very heavy, especially if you plan to use granite or marble tiles. You need to know whether your floor can handle the weight of a spa-tub (when full) or a multi-head walk in shower with a lot of tile.
What if Space is Limited?
Another factor to consider is space. How big is the bathroom? Smaller bathrooms require scaled down fixtures. For instance, contemporary bathroom design might incorporate an above counter basin. This option for a basin is great for smaller bathrooms because the basin is the focal point – you can use a smaller cabinet as the base.
Do you have a small bathroom with a bath/shower combination? One option to consider is replacing the bathtub with a large shower pan. Your former bathtub becomes a walk-in shower. Add some beautiful tile with bathroom accessories such a tiled soap tray, or heated towel racks. You may have what’s technically considered a “smaller” bathroom, but it’s far more luxurious, functional and inviting.

Marble is quite similar to limestone. Both are used for interior decoration and have equal class and sophistication about them. However, people normally go for marbles, despite the higher price range. The main reason is that marbles stand out from the rest and can make a distinct impression about household. But remember that marbles require higher maintenance than other materials for home décor. They need to be cleaned, polished and sealed regularly. Care should also be taken as not to crack them!

There are honed and tumbled or simple polished marble for your bathroom. Tumble tiles are made in a combination of sand and after few years it becomes sounded and edges chipped. But instead of destroying the beauty it actually enhances the attractiveness of the place. They give an antique and classic look your bathroom. Tumbled tiles are extremely popular nowadays and are used in kitchens, terraces and bathrooms. They are also much safe than the polished variety. The latter looks sophisticated but they become slippery once they are wet. This can lead to unwanted accidents at home. Tumbled tiles on the other hand are rough and produce friction, thus minimizing the chance of slipping on them. This they are perfect for bathrooms, the wettest of all places in the house!
